Production
The grapes came from the Heppenheim Centgericht vineyard in the Hessische Bergstraße, a region known for its favourable climate and Riesling cultivation. Eiswein is made from grapes harvested while naturally frozen, concentrating sugars, acids and flavour compounds as frozen water remains behind in the press. A must weight of 210° Oechsle indicates an exceptionally concentrated harvest. Further details of the 1987 vinification are not available, but the wine was bottled in the traditional 750 ml format.

Producer
Kloster Eberbach is one of Germany’s historic wine estates, founded by Cistercian monks in 1136 in the Rheingau. The estate became renowned for its Riesling and Pinot Noir, and its wines have long played an important role in the reputation of the Rheingau and surrounding Hessian wine regions. The Staatsweingüter Eltville designation reflects the state-owned wine estate associated with this distinguished historic producer.
